Solar panel systems have become increasingly popular due to advancements in technology and decreasing costs
. Over the past decade, the cost of installing solar has dropped by more than 70%, making it more accessible than ever before. However, the overall cost of a solar panel system is influenced by several factors such as the size of the system, installation complexity, location, and choice of solar panel brands. The typical cost range for a residential solar panel system is between $15,000 and $25,000 before any tax credits or incentives. This upfront cost includes solar panels, inverters, mounting equipment, as well as installation labor. It’s important to consider that these are initial costs; solar energy systems can provide significant savings over time. On average, a household can save approximately $600 to $1,000 annually on electricity bills, depending on location and energy usage.

When exploring the cost of a solar panel system, it's crucial to evaluate federal and state incentives that can further reduce expenses. In many regions, there are tax credits, rebates, and other incentives available to support solar adoption. For example, in the United States, the Federal Solar Investment Tax Credit (ITC) offers a 30% tax credit, significantly lowering the effective cost of the system. The expertise in choosing the right type of solar panels and systems plays a pivotal role in determining both efficiency and long-term savings. Monocrystalline panels, known for their high efficiency and sleek appearance, typically come at a higher cost compared to polycrystalline panels or thin-film solar panels. However, for homes or businesses with limited roof space, monocrystalline panels can be more cost-effective in the long run due to their superior performance. Authoritativeness in the solar industry is reflected by the certifications and warranties offered by manufacturers and installers. Homeowners and businesses are encouraged to select solar panel systems from reputable manufacturers who provide comprehensive warranties. Typically, these warranties span 25 years, covering either performance or product quality.
